Thanksgiving Day is celebrated in the United States on the last Thursday in November. This holiday is one of the big six major holidays of the year. People of all faiths celebrate this day. They give thanks for the many good things in their lives.

A group of people (Pilgrims) decided to leave England for America. They wanted to be free to practice their religion. They wanted a new and better life. On the 16 th September they left England. There were about a hundred of them. Their ship was called “Mayflower ”.

The Pilgrims’ first winter was very difficult. They had arrived too late to grow any crops. Without fresh food half of the Pilgrims died.

There were people living in America before the Pilgrims arrived. These people were the Native American Indians. They hunted, fished and farmed to survive.

The Indians shared their knowledge of hunting, fishing  and farming . They also taught the Pilgrims how to grow corn.

The colonists had much to be thankful for, so they planned a feast. Local Indian chief and ninety Indians were present.

They prepared a big dinner of turkey, corn, beans and pumpkins. They invited their Indian friends to share this three day feast. The Indians brought their food to the feast, too.

American still celebrate Thanksgiving day in the fall. Turkey is still the main dish and pumpkin pie and cranberry pie are the most popular desserts.

It reminds us that our food comes from the earth. Indian corn is used as a decoration. People usually go to church in the morning or in the afternoon. All people give thanks for the good things that they have.
